6th – 11th Grade Crestfield Service Adventure Camp July 20-25

This camp is for kids in grades 6th - 11th grade and costs $400 per person.  Monday through Thursday campers go off site during the day to do service projects in the local community, then return to Crestfield to have free time at the pool followed by dinner.  In the evenings campers do camp activities and participate in a lively club time.  Please use this link to indicate your interest and to see who else is going from our church.  

 

Return Mission Trip to Spruce Pine, NC. June 22 - 28

Building off our desire to offer more intergenerational opportunities, we are planning another Mission Trip to Western, NC.  This trip is for any youth currently in seventh grade or older, including young adults/adults.  We are also teaming up with three other local PCUSA congregations for this trip.  We will partner again with Baptists on Mission, and hope to return to Spruce Pine, where we sent a team of eight to serve in December.  While they are not yet requiring payment for mission trips, a suggested donation of $120 per person is being collected, which Bower Hill will donate to BOM to cover the cost of volunteering.  Please use this link to indicate your interest and to see who else is going from our church.

Bower Hill follows a unique youth-leader model.  Pre-school (potty trained) through 3rd

grade attend from 9:30 a.m. - noon each day.  Older youth from 4th grade and up serve as helpers in the morning, then stay through 3:00 p.m. each day for more in-depth activities just for them.
